One of the "follies" built by the new aristocracy and court advisors of the 17th century, this beautifully constructed and restored chateau is surrounded by immaculate gardens and includes a rare collection of Flemish tapestries, fine Louis XV and XVI furnishings. On site: the FOLIA restaurant and a winery with vineyard visits and wine tastings.
